Talisman Capital Partners is a VC fund in Columbus focused on Health Care and Information Services. Talisman Capital Partners operates as a private investment company.

Prilenia is a clinical-stage biotech company that develops novel treatments for neurodegenerative and neurodevelopmental disorders. Its lead asset is Pridopidine, a n oral drug candidate with an established safety profile and potential in multiple movement disorders and neurodegenerative diseases affecting adults and children.The company wasfounded in 2018 and is based in Israel, the Netherlands, and Boston. | $43M / Series B / Nov 03, 2021 | |
